ln Vitro |
1. Creation of a functioning solution for ER-Tracker 1.1 To produce a stock solution, use 128 μL of anhydrous DMSO; to prepare a 1 mM stock solution, load 100 μg of ER-Tracker. Note: It is advised to aliquot and store the ER-Tracker storage solution at -20°C or -1.2 Features of the working solution. To make a 100 nM-1 μM ER-Tracker working solution, use pre-made serum-free cell culture medium or PBS perfusion solution. Note: Please modify the ER-80°C to prevent light storage based on the current circumstances. 2. Staining suspended cells using cell dye 2.1 Centrifuge the cells, add PBS, and wash twice for five minutes each time. The density of cells is 1×106/mL. 2.2 For five to thirty minutes, add 1 mL of the ER-Tracker working solution. 2.3 Centrifuge for 3–4 minutes at 400 g, then remove the supernatant. 2.4 Wash the cells twice with PBS, giving them five minutes each time. 2.5 Use one milliliter of PBS or serum-free. 3. Staining adherent cells in cells 3.1 Use sterile coverslips to culture the adhering cells. 3.2 Take off the coverslip and aspirate the leftover material from the cells. 3.3 Add 100 μL of the dye working solution, give the cells a full shake to coat them, and stain for five to thirty minutes. 3.4 Use a fluorescence microscope, aspirate the dye working solution, and wash with culture media two to three times for five minutes each time. Note: The cells must be digested with islets and stopped before staining if flow cytometry is needed for detection.
